What is the best homemade face mask for skin tightening?

Many internet tutorials claim that the best homemade face mask for skin tightening involves using egg whites, lemon juice, or yogurt. These recipes are popular because they are inexpensive and easy to find in most kitchens. Egg whites contain a protein called albumin, which contracts as it dries on the surface of the face, creating a physical pulling sensation that many users mistake for actual lifting. However, this effect is entirely temporary and washes away the moment you rinse your face.

Other common ingredients include honey for its humectant properties and banana for its potassium content. While these substances may hydrate the top layer of the skin, they do not possess the ability to stimulate new collagen production. The molecules in food grade ingredients are simply too large to penetrate the skin barrier effectively. To truly address sagging, you need ingredients designed to interact with your cells on a biological level.

Dermatological risks of a homemade face mask for sagging skin

Applying raw food products to your face carries significant risks that most DIY blogs fail to mention. Unlike laboratory tested skincare, kitchen ingredients are not sterile and can introduce harmful bacteria into your pores. This is particularly dangerous if you have small cuts, active acne, or a compromised skin barrier. Common risks of DIY masks include:

  • Bacterial Contamination: Raw eggs can carry salmonella, and unpasteurized honey may contain various microbes that cause infections.
  • pH Imbalance: Ingredients like lemon juice and apple cider vinegar are highly acidic, which can strip your skin of its natural oils and cause chemical burns.
  • Phytophotodermatitis: Citrus juices contain compounds that react with sunlight, potentially leading to severe blistering and dark spots if you go outside after a DIY treatment.
  • Allergic Reactions: Concentrated food particles can trigger contact dermatitis, leading to redness, itching, and swelling.

Why structural sagging requires professional intervention

Sagging skin is a structural issue caused by the depletion of collagen and elastin fibers in the middle layer of the skin, known as the dermis. Gravity and time also contribute to the shifting of fat pads underneath the skin. A homemade face mask for sagging skin only sits on the epidermis, which is the very top layer. It cannot reach the deep layers where the actual support structures are located.

How can I tighten my saggy face naturally?

If you prefer a natural approach, focus on lifestyle habits that support your skin's biological functions rather than reaching for the refrigerator. One of the most effective natural methods is consistent sun protection. UV rays are the primary cause of collagen breakdown, so wearing a broad spectrum sunscreen every day is the best way to prevent further sagging. Facial massage and Gua Sha are other natural techniques that help improve blood circulation and lymphatic drainage. While these methods do not permanently remove excess skin, they can reduce puffiness and define the jawline, giving the face a more lifted appearance. Additionally, maintaining a diet rich in antioxidants and vitamin C provides your body with the building blocks it needs to synthesize new collagen internally.

What tightens skin immediately?

Immediate skin tightening is usually the result of temporary physical or chemical reactions on the skin surface. Cooling your skin with cold water or a chilled facial roller can cause the blood vessels to constrict, resulting in a temporary reduction in redness and a slight firming effect. What face mask is good for tightening skin?

The best face masks for tightening are those that contain bio active ingredients like peptides, niacinamide, and hydrolyzed collagen. Peptides are small chains of amino acids that act as messengers, telling your skin to produce more collagen. Niacinamide helps strengthen the skin barrier and improves elasticity over time.
